Output 574d91d138c2a406694da602d2055e7b8a8735beb7c7fe8402e6aa62baa7ea5a:0

value
24140589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73ba91e82091512ed6aa44a2b9688f9f495b5204 OP_EQUALVERIFY OP_CHECKSIG
address
1BYvDAjLxTvcySf1oyMMNo3kGXrzoMSXg7
transaction
574d91d138c2a406694da602d2055e7b8a8735beb7c7fe8402e6aa62baa7ea5a
spent
true